Google pay is a mobile-based application, which is facilitating real-time money transfer through UPI. What is UPI? We all might have come across or even used it recently. Let's understand it better.. Unified payment interface (UPI) is a unique user ID that a bank uses to accomplish real-time money transactions. The National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) set up by the Reserve bank of India and the Indian Banks Association backs UPI.
